Tutorial Session at IEEE ICMLCNC 2024
May 08, 2024
Jorge Torres Gomez gave a tutorial titled "Machine Learning in the IOBNT: Exploting the Potentail of Nano-Scale Communication and Computing" at the IEEE International Conference on Machine Learning for Communication and Networking (ICMLCN 2024), which was held in Stockholm, Sweden. The tutorial was prepared in collaboration with Roya Khanzadeh and Stefan Angerbauer from the Johannes Kepler Universitaet Linz. The session introduced the role of Machine Learning (ML) algorithms in the Internet of Bio-Nano Things (IoBNT), which is an emerging communication framework in the nanoscale.

April 16, 2024
The TKN group presented two research talks at 8th Workshop on Molecular Communications 2024. Saswati Pal analyzed how decay rates affect nanosensor performance, revealing that higher decay rates reduce variance in detection ratios. In a second talk, Lisa Y. Debus presented a reinforcement learning-based synchronizer to continually adapt a decoding threshold and detect transmitted synchronization frames in a dynamic molecular communication environment.CCS on Tour 2024
